What is a triple-column cash book?

Short Answer

A triple column cash book is a type of cash book that records cash, bank, and discount transactions. It has three amount columns on each side, one for cash, one for bank, and one for discount. This helps in maintaining detailed financial records.

It is useful for businesses with many transactions. It provides complete information about cash, bank balance, and discounts allowed or received.

Triple Column Cash Book

Meaning

A triple column cash book is an advanced type of cash book used in accounting. It is called “triple column” because it has three columns on each side. These columns are for cash, bank, and discount. This type of cash book records all cash transactions, bank transactions, and discounts allowed and received.

Whenever a business receives money, the entry is recorded on the debit side. If any discount is allowed to the customer, it is recorded in the discount column on the debit side. Similarly, when the business makes a payment, the entry is recorded on the credit side, and any discount received is recorded in the discount column on the credit side.

Structure

The triple column cash book has two sides: debit and credit. Each side contains three columns: cash, bank, and discount.

On the debit side, all receipts are recorded. This includes cash received, money deposited in the bank, and discount allowed. On the credit side, all payments are recorded. This includes cash payments, payments made through the bank, and discount received.

At the end of a period, the cash and bank columns are balanced separately. The discount columns are not balanced but are totaled and later transferred to discount accounts.

Features

The triple column cash book has many useful features. It records three types of transactions in one book, which makes it very detailed and complete.

It acts as both a journal and a ledger, which simplifies the accounting process. Transactions are recorded in date order, which helps in maintaining proper records.

Another important feature is the recording of discounts. It helps businesses keep track of discounts allowed to customers and discounts received from suppliers.

The triple column cash book also includes contra entries. These occur when money is transferred between cash and bank, such as depositing cash into the bank or withdrawing cash from the bank.

Uses

This type of cash book is used by businesses that have a large number of transactions and frequently deal with banks and discounts. It is suitable for medium and large businesses.

It helps in keeping detailed records and provides a clear picture of financial activities. This makes it easier to manage finances and make better decisions.

Importance

Detailed Record Keeping

The triple column cash book provides complete information about cash, bank, and discounts. This helps in maintaining detailed and organized records.

Better Financial Control

By recording all types of transactions, it helps businesses control their finances more effectively.

Helps in Decision Making

The information recorded in the cash book helps business owners make better financial decisions.

Saves Time and Effort

Since it combines multiple functions, it reduces the need for separate books and saves time.
